注意事项与替代方案 位掩码的局限性: 这种基于单个整数位掩码的方法,其能处理的最大数字范围受限于整数的位数。
数据表需设计position列以存储顺序,查询时按该字段排序。
想快速上手PHP开发,Laravel是一个极佳的选择。
条件判断: 在 wrapper 函数中,每次执行被装饰函数前,检查当前计数器是否已达到或超过 DEPTH。
我们的目标是创建一个新的二维数组 $final,其中 $colors 数组中的每个颜色值作为 $final 数组的键,而 $test 数组中的对应键值对则成为 $final 数组中每个键的子数组,子数组包含 name 和 value 两个键。
简单来说,json.dump()用于写入,json.load()用于读取。
4. 使用模板引擎(如Twig、Smarty) 高级项目常使用模板引擎,在HTML中调用PHP函数更安全、清晰。
因此,可以在程序启动时保存之前的 GOMAXPROCS 值,并在程序退出时将其恢复。
离开作用域后,a 和 b 的 shared_ptr 被销毁,引用计数减为1,但不会归零,析构函数不被调用,造成内存泄漏。
当一个变量的作用域清晰、边界明确时,我们就能更容易地理解代码的意图,预测它的行为。
注意事项: subprocess 模块创建了一个新的进程来执行 pip 命令,与当前 Python 进程隔离,更加安全。
注意事项与最佳实践 性能考量: 对于包含大量文章的网站,批量更新操作可能会消耗较多服务器资源。
遇到重复引用时,先看 graph 再调 require,问题通常很快就能解决。
date := time.Date(year, 0, 0, 0, 0, 0, 0, timezone) // 2. 迭代向后,找到当前日期所在ISO周的周一。
AJAX 文件上传原理 在使用 AJAX 进行文件上传时,我们通常会遇到关于并发处理的疑问,特别是当涉及到 PHP 的 $_FILES 超全局变量时。
立即学习“C++免费学习笔记(深入)”; auto p = std::make_shared<int>(100); std::shared_ptr<int> q = p; // 引用计数变为 2 std::shared_ptr<int> r; r = p; // 引用计数变为 3 当 p、q、r 都离开作用域后,引用计数归零,内存自动释放。
3、了解索引优化与执行计划分析以提升查询性能。
vector 使用灵活、性能良好,是替代原生数组的首选。
XQuery作为数据库的查询语言,可以直接利用这些底层优化。
C++实现中使用共享指针管理状态生命周期,避免循环依赖。
本文链接:http://www.douglasjamesguitar.com/272120_912546.html